One of the biggest ways NJ contractors waste Google Ads budget is showing up for the wrong searches — DIY how-to searches, out-of-area clicks, and competitor name searches. We build aggressive negative keyword lists from day one, shaped by what we've learned managing NJ trades accounts.
HVAC searches spike in June and again in November. Plumbing emergency searches peak after cold snaps. We adjust bids, budgets, and ad scheduling around your seasonal demand curve — not a generic schedule that treats July and January identically.
Sending Google Ads traffic to your homepage kills conversion rates. We build or optimize dedicated landing pages for each campaign — specific to the service, the town, and the search intent. Higher Quality Scores, lower CPCs, more calls.

These two programs work differently, appear in different positions on Google, and charge you differently. Understanding both is essential to building an efficient NJ trades lead generation system.
Pay-per-lead, not pay-per-click. You only pay when a customer contacts you.
Traditional PPC — pay per click regardless of contact. More control, broader reach.
Our recommendation for most NJ trades businesses:
Run both. LSA captures the highest-intent, lowest-cost leads. Google Search Ads fill in the gaps — seasonal campaigns, specific service pages, and markets where LSA coverage is thin. Together, they dominate the top of the page across every relevant search.

For most NJ trades businesses, a monthly ad spend of $1,500–$4,000 is a reasonable starting point depending on your trade and service area. HVAC and plumbing in competitive Bergen County markets can require $3,000–$5,000/month in ad spend to maintain consistent lead volume during peak seasons. We recommend starting with a 60-day test budget and scaling based on cost-per-lead data.
You can run Google Ads yourself, but most contractors who do end up spending significantly more per lead than those working with a specialist. Trades PPC has a steep learning curve — keyword match types, negative keyword lists, geo-targeting radius, ad scheduling by day and hour, and Quality Score optimization all make a meaningful difference in cost-per-lead. A well-managed account typically reduces cost-per-lead by 30–50% versus a self-managed account.
Google Ads (Search campaigns) are traditional pay-per-click ads that appear above organic results. You pay when someone clicks your ad, regardless of whether they contact you. Local Services Ads (LSA) appear even higher — at the very top of the page — and you only pay when a customer calls, texts, or emails you directly through the ad. LSA also include a "Google Guaranteed" badge that significantly increases trust. For NJ trades, we typically recommend running both: LSA for the highest-intent leads at the lowest cost, and Google Ads to capture broader search volume.
